This master's-level programme develops technical and practical expertise in computer networking, telecommunications systems and associated software, suitable for graduates who want to design, manage and secure modern communications infrastructures. It suits computer science, computer engineering or related discipline holders seeking careers in network engineering, telecoms, cloud networking or research and development in Silicon Valley and beyond.
The programme combines theoretical foundations with hands-on laboratories and a substantial capstone or thesis component. Core topics typically include network architecture and protocols, routing and switching, wireless and mobile communications, and telecommunication systems. Students study network security, network management and performance analysis, distributed systems and cloud networking, and gain practical skills in network programming and systems integration.
Applicants are normally expected to hold a bachelor's degree in computer science, computer engineering, electrical engineering, or a closely related discipline. Strong undergraduate preparation in programming, data structures, operating systems, and basic networking is expected. Where background gaps exist, applicants may be required to take prerequisite courses.
Graduates move into technical and leadership roles across networking and telecommunications sectors, technology companies, service providers and infrastructure vendors. The programme prepares students for positions that require both practical engineering skills and system-level understanding.
Located in the heart of the Silicon Valley region, San Jose University offers strong industry connections, frequent guest lectures and internship opportunities with networking and telecommunications employers. The university’s faculty combine academic research with industry experience, and students benefit from laboratory facilities, networking testbeds and partnerships with local technology firms. Career services and an active alumni network support transitions into local and global roles in telecoms and networking.
